Genesis, Contact gain from temporary Methanex shutdown

Genesis and Contact Energy are buying gas from Methanex after the methanol manufacturer decided to mothball its New Zealand operations until the end of October.A lack of gas has affected Methanex's operations as it competes with demand from other users.New Zealand Exchange-listed (NZX) Genesis said the electricity system was under stress from low hydro levels, calm wind conditions and a limited gas supply to support backup generation. In recent years, around 10% of the country’s electricity has been generated using gas.Contact...
